What are the Different Methods for Decaffeinating Tea?
Several methods exist for removing caffeine from tea leaves, each with its own advantages and disadvantages. Understanding these processes will help you appreciate the decaf tea you purchase and even attempt some methods at home.
1. Water Process (Swiss Water Process):
This is a popular method considered to be one of the purest and most effective. It involves steeping green tea leaves in hot water, which draws out the caffeine and other water-soluble compounds. This caffeine-rich water is then passed through activated carbon filters, which absorb the caffeine. The process is repeated several times, resulting in a highly decaffeinated tea that retains more of its flavor and aroma than other methods. The Swiss Water Process is often considered a premium decaffeination method.
2. Ethyl Acetate Method:
This method uses ethyl acetate, a natural solvent also found in fruits and some wines, to remove caffeine. The tea leaves are soaked in ethyl acetate, which dissolves the caffeine. The solvent is then removed, leaving the decaffeinated tea leaves. While effective, some people have concerns about the use of solvents, although the amount remaining is typically minimal and considered safe.
3. Supercritical Carbon Dioxide Method:
This method utilizes supercritical carbon dioxide, a substance that exists in a state between a liquid and a gas under high pressure and temperature. The supercritical CO2 acts as a solvent, extracting the caffeine without damaging the tea's flavor components. This is generally considered a safe and effective method that retains a high level of flavor and aroma in the finished product.
4. Methylene Chloride Method:
Historically, methylene chloride was a common decaffeination solvent. However, due to concerns about its potential health effects, its use is now less prevalent. Many tea companies have shifted to gentler methods.
Can I Decaf Tea at Home?
While achieving perfect decaffeination at home is difficult, you can reduce the caffeine content using a few simple techniques:
Reducing Brewing Time and Temperature:
Brewing tea for a shorter time and at a lower temperature will extract less caffeine. Experiment to find your preferred balance between strength and caffeine level.
Multiple Infusions:
Steep the tea leaves in hot water for a short time, discard the first infusion, and then steep again for a shorter period. This process will remove a portion of the caffeine with each infusion, although it won't remove it completely.
How Much Caffeine is Removed?
The amount of caffeine removed varies depending on the method used. The Swiss Water Process generally removes a high percentage of caffeine, while other methods may leave a slightly higher residual amount. Always check the product label for specific caffeine content information.
Is Decaffeinated Tea Healthy?
Decaffeinated tea still retains many of the beneficial antioxidants and other compounds found in regular tea. However, the decaffeination process can slightly alter the nutritional profile.
What are the Benefits of Drinking Decaffeinated Tea?
Many enjoy decaf tea for its flavor and aroma without the stimulating effects of caffeine. This makes it a great choice for evening relaxation or individuals sensitive to caffeine.
Does Decaf Tea Still Have Antioxidants?
Yes, decaffeinated tea still contains many beneficial antioxidants, though the exact amount may vary slightly depending on the decaffeination method.
How Does Decaffeination Affect the Flavor of Tea?
While modern decaffeination methods strive to minimize impact, there might be subtle differences in flavor compared to regular tea. Some people find decaf tea slightly milder in taste.
